About this form

A Complaint is a legal document that initiates a lawsuit, providing a formal statement of the allegations by the Plaintiff against the Defendant. This particular Complaint is specifically designed to address disputes arising from automobile accidents. Unlike other legal documents, it serves as the foundation for legal action, explicitly outlining the Plaintiff's claims and desired resolutions.

Key parts of this document

  • Identification of the Plaintiff and Defendant
  • Statement of jurisdiction and venue
  • Detailed allegations of the incident
  • Description of injuries and damages, including medical expenses
  • Request for relief or specific remedies sought by the Plaintiff

When this form is needed

This Complaint should be used when an individual wishes to file a lawsuit regarding an automobile accident. It is applicable in situations where the Plaintiff seeks compensation for injuries, medical expenses, pain and suffering, or other damages resulting from the accident. It sets the stage for legal proceedings and ensures that the Defendant is formally notified of the claims against them.

Who needs this form

  • Individuals who have been injured in an automobile accident
  • Persons seeking to claim damages for pain and suffering
  • Litigants looking to initiate a legal dispute in court

How to prepare this document

  • Identify the parties involved by entering the names of the Plaintiff and Defendant.
  • Clearly state the jurisdiction, providing relevant details about where the lawsuit is being filed.
  • Outline the facts of the case, detailing the events that led to the automobile accident.
  • Specify the types of damages being claimed, including injuries and expenses incurred.
  • Sign and date the complaint before filing it with the court.

Typical mistakes to avoid

  • Failing to correctly identify all parties involved in the accident
  • Omitting essential details about the incident and injuries
  • Not adhering to local court rules regarding filing procedures
  • Neglecting to include a specific request for relief
